Frequently Asked Questions about Southeast Queens

How much are Studio apartments in Southeast Queens?

There are currently 380 Studio Apartments in Southeast Queens with rent ranges from $1,275 to $7,250 with an average price of $2,664.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Southeast Queens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Southeast Queens ranges from $1,260 to $4,883 with an average monthly rent of $2,681.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Southeast Queens c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Southeast Queens range from $1,920 to $6,570.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,103.

How expensive are Southeast Queens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 326 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Southeast Queens on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$2,700 to $8,884 - averaging $3,471 for the location.
